pub struct BytesCows<'a, Offset: OffsetType = u32, Length: LengthType = u16> { /* private fields */ }Expand description
A memory-efficient collection of byte slices with configurable offset and length types.
Similar to CharsCows but for arbitrary binary data without UTF-8 validation.

Creates BytesCows from iterator of byte slices and shared data buffer.
Slices must be subslices of the data buffer. Offsets and lengths are inferred from slice pointers.

Sourcepub fn as_chars(&self) -> Result<CharsCows<'_, Offset, Length>, StringTapeError>
pub fn as_chars(&self) -> Result<CharsCows<'_, Offset, Length>, StringTapeError>
Returns a zero-copy view of this BytesCows as a CharsCows if all slices are valid UTF-8.
This validates that all byte slices contain valid UTF-8, then reinterprets the collection as strings without copying or moving any data.
§Errors
Returns StringTapeError::Utf8Error if any slice contains invalid UTF-8.
§Examples
use stringtape::BytesCowsU32U8;
use std::borrow::Cow;
let data = b"hello world";
let bytes = BytesCowsU32U8::from_iter_and_data(
data.split(|&b| b == b' '),
Cow::Borrowed(&data[..])
).unwrap();
let chars = bytes.as_chars().unwrap();
assert_eq!(chars.get(0), Some("hello"));
assert_eq!(chars.get(1), Some("world"));
